Lobby Filtering and Game Discovery

Finding a specific title across thousands of options usually causes frustration on mobile screens. Looniegold addresses this by building 13 distinct lobby categories directly into the horizontal scroll filter. You can instantly toggle between Pragmatic Play 1000, Jackpots, Megaways, Bonus Buy, New, Crash Games, and Slots without digging through nested directories. I tested the responsiveness of these filters, and the UI updates the game grid in under half a second. Titles visible in the updated lobby include Gates of Olympus Super Scatter, Book of Dead, Le Bandit, Sugar Rush Super Scatter, and Vortex by Turbo Games. Each game card clearly displays its metadata, and certain tiles even include a demo play option for testing mechanics before risking real funds. The search bar remains fixed at the top of the viewport, ensuring you never lose your place while exploring the library.

Payment Integration and Compliance Display

Handling banking on mobile requires clear visual cues and fast transaction paths. The footer and cashier sections explicitly display supported payment logos for Interac, Mastercard, Visa, Tether, and Bitcoin, bridging traditional fiat rails with crypto assets. I examined the legal and compliance disclosures located in the footer, which state that the site is owned and operated by 3-102-949677 SRL under the trade name NEMO LIMITADA. Registered in Costa Rica with the address in Provincia 06 Puntarenas, the platform operates under a valid license. Specifically, it holds License Number ALSI-202601006-FI1 issued by Anjouan Licensing Services Inc., under the authority of the Government of the Autonomous Island of Anjouan, Union of Comoros. Support options are equally accessible, featuring a 24/7 live chat button pinned to the sidebar and a dedicated FAQ menu to resolve account queries quickly.
